Till Lindemann is leaving Rammstein behind in 2024.
Starting in September, the bombastic frontman will embark on his first solo U.S. tour with special guests Twin Temple and Aesthetic Perfection in support of his 2023 solo album “Zunge.”
Midway through the fall run, the 61-year-old drops into New York’s The Rooftop at Pier 17 on Tuesday, Oct. 1.
While this will be Lindemann’s first solo stateside jaunt, it won’t be the first time he’s performed without Rammstein.
Most recently, he wrapped an international 2023-24 solo tour in Mexico, according to Set List FM . On that run, he regularly performed 19 songs — including two encores — per show.

On Nov. 3, 2023, Lindemann dropped his solo album “Zunge.”
Comprised of 11 tracks, the heavy rocker stretches his musical muscles and alternates between intimate quiet and chaotic, epic loud — the sound Rammstein is known for — with ease.
Highlights include the quirky “Sports Frei,” thumping “Altes Fleisch” and warbly anthem “Du hast kein Herz.”
Personally, we were most taken with the Ennio Morricone-esque “Tanzlehrerin” with its guitar licks, yearning vocals and gifted yet pained backing singer giving her all behind Lindemann.
Don’t sleep on the shockingly fun album closer “Selbst verliebt,” either. It’s an unexpected pop delicacy.

Lindemann was accused of sexual assault by a female fan last June over social media. She alleged he drugged her at a pre-show Rammstein VIP party in Lithuania and later approached her fox sex during intermission.
This led to backlash against Rammstein’s “VIP Experience;” fans believed Lindemann was using the ticket tier to bed fans.
After looking into the case, German prosectors dropped the case due to lack of evidence and testimony.
“The rapid termination of investigative proceedings by the Berlin state prosecutor’s office shows that there is insufficient evidence that our client allegedly committed sexual offen(s)es,” Lindemann’s lawyers said.
Rammstein drummer claimed Lindemann “has distanced himself from us in recent years and created his own bubble” and “things seem to have happened that, although legally ok, I personally don’t think are ok.”

Rammstein pull out rarities in first show of 2023
Rammstein are back on tour, but their first show of 2023 held a few setlist surprises - including a live debut
Nobody does live spectacle like Rammstein . Germany's premiere metal export might have become known for having more pyro than a blaze in a fireworks factory and explosions so loud they can be heard 11 miles away , but that doesn't mean you can ever predict what form their latest show will take.
So we won't pretend to not be excited at the prospect of the band breaking out rarities for their first show of 2023, including one song they've never played . On Saturday May 20 2023, Rammstein kicked off their 2023 tour plans with a 'dress rehearsal' show for fan club members at Vingis Park in Lithuania.
Opening with Liebe ist für alle da opening track Rammlied - played for the first time since 2011 - as a glowing-faced and mohawked Till Lindemann was lowered on a huge elevator like an industrial metal jack-o'-lantern, the show was packed with hits and rarities alike, alongside the usual levels of pyro and insanity we've come to adore from the German metal masters.
The band are hardly going to drop the likes of Du Hast or Links 2 3 4 from their sets, but Bestrafe Mich also made its first appearance in the band's setlists since 2001, while Zeit' s propulsive industrial metal banger Giftig was played live for the first time ever.
With tour dates announced to take them around Europe until October - and a newly announced Lindemann solo tour for the end of the year - it looks like the Rammstein lads will be busy for much of 2023, offering plenty more opportunities for the band to drop plenty of rarities and hits alike, with the band returning to Vingis Park tonight (May 22) for the 'official' start of their 2023 tour.

I went to see Rammstein live during their 2005 tour, in Nîmes. The open-air Roman amphitheater was perfect for a gig on a warm summer night in southern France, and was particularly suitable for Rammstein.
Once the sun was completely set, Rammstein came on stage to their opening song, “Reise, reise”, introducing themselves one by one, rising to the stage. After a couple of songs spent warming up, the pyrotechnics kicked in to “Feuer Frei”, with flamethrowers attached to their faces, and we were in for a hell of a show. “Fire at will” (the name of the song) was an appropriate statement as they filled the whole Arena with fire and smoke, making the warm summer night feel like a very cold breeze when the flames finally stopped.
Rammstein are world-famous for their live performances, including the heavy use of both lights and fire during their shows. Till Lindemann, the lead singer, is a certified pyrotechnician, and plays with his skill well during the show. He dresses as a cook in order to roast “Flake”, the band’s pianist, in a giant pot during “Mein teil” using a flamethrower. In another instance, he just showers in sparkles coming from fireworks all over the stage. Their use of fire-spitting devices is a constant during the show, and makes for incredible visual effects across the whole performance.
A dozen or so of songs later, once the warmth of fire and smoke start to take its toll, it is time for a walkabout for “Ollie”, the bassist, as he boards an inflatable boat and goes on a raft, on top of the crowd. After a few minutes of going up and down the whole venue, it’s time to get back on the stage, and to finish delighting the crowd with some classic songs, and an amazing encore.

RAMMSTEIN's first show of 2023: See setlist and videos from fan-club exclusive gig
On Saturday (May 20th), Rammstein played their first show of 2023 — an exclusive, fan-club-only dress-rehearsal performance that test-drove the massive 21-song setlist and pyro-heavy production of the German industrial-metal titans' upcoming tour dates.
Held at Vingio Parkas in Vilnius, Lithuania — where Rammstein are set to kick off their 2023 tour proper tonight (May 22nd) — the dress rehearsal saw the Duetschlandic firestarters crank out live-staple fan favorites ("Du Hast," "Sonne," "Links 2-3-4") and deep-cut rarities alike.
Among the latter were Liebe ist für alle da' s "Rammlied" (played for the first time since 2011 while frontman Till Lindeman descended to the stage on a huge elevator), Sehnsucht' s "Bestrafe Mich" (played for the first time since 2001) and "Giftig," off the group's latest album, Zeit , which got its live debut.

The Rammstein Stadium Tour is the seventh ongoing concert tour by German Neue Deutsche Härte band Rammstein, originally in support of their 2019 untitled studio album, but then Zeit as well in 2022 and onwards, [1] with a total of 58 shows in 2019. It grossed more than $64,000,000 by the end of 2018 in pre-sales. [2]
